考研编程题怎么准备

时间:2025-03-01 06:22:26 明星趣事

准备考研编程题需要系统性的复习和大量的实践。以下是一些建议,帮助你高效准备:

基础知识学习

确保你对编程的基础知识有深入的理解,包括数据结构(如数组、链表、栈、队列、树、图等)、算法(如排序算法、查找算法、动态规划、贪心算法、回溯算法等)和编程语言(如Python、Java、C等)。

审题与理解

在开始解题之前,仔细阅读题目,理解题目要求,并标记出关键信息。

整理思路

在纸上先列出解题思路,通过实例验证思路的正确性,并找出可能存在的问题。

方法选择

根据题目要求选择合适的算法或数据结构来解决问题。

代码书写

注意代码的结构、可读性和效率。遵循编程规范,合理使用注释。

练习与积累

通过大量练习来积累解题经验,对于常见的题型,要熟练掌握其解题方法和思路。

可以选择一些专门为考研准备的编程题库进行练习,如LeetCode、牛客网、力扣等。

创新思维

在积累的基础上,尝试对已有方法进行改进或创新,以应对可能出现的变种题目。

模拟考试

定期进行模拟考试,以适应考试环境和时间限制。

回顾与总结

完成练习后,回顾并总结自己的错误和不足,以便下次改进。

参考资料

利用相关教材、参考书籍、在线资源等,加深理解和学习。

注重细节和边界情况

在编程过程中,要注重细节和边界情况的考虑,确保程序的正确性和健壮性。

编程风格的规范和代码的可读性

在面试过程中,除了正确解答问题外,还应注意编程风格的规范和代码的可读性,注重代码的模块化和封装,展示良好的编程习惯和思维方式。

通过以上步骤,你可以系统地准备考研编程题,提高解题能力和应试技巧。